The original Linka mine produced tungsten, specifically as the mineral scheelite, or calcium tungstate, which was processed into tungsten trioxide. Ten samples from the historical mill’s run-of-mine, or “ROM” pad, averaged a solid 0.5 per cent tungsten trioxide, up to an impressive 1.8 per cent. A second pile of mixed ore and waste material returned an average of 0.1 per cent tungsten trioxide. The work has confirmed multiple zones of tungsten at surface, including a one metre hit going 1.3 per cent tungsten trioxide, a 3m intercept grading 0.5 per cent tungsten trioxide and a wider 5m zone at 0.4 per cent tungsten trioxide.
